._header_1nayg_1{--header-h: var(--space-16);background-color:var(--background);position:relative;z-index:1001;min-height:var(--header-h)}._headerSticky_1nayg_9{position:sticky;top:0;box-shadow:0 0 #0000;animation:_header-shadow_1nayg_1 linear both;animation-timeline:scroll();animation-range:0px 1px}@keyframes _header-shadow_1nayg_1{to{box-shadow:var(--shadow-md)}}._headerBar_1nayg_24{display:flex;justify-content:space-between;align-items:center;position:relative;min-height:var(--header-h)}._logoLink_1nayg_32{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);display:flex;align-items:center}._logo_1nayg_32{height:var(--space-10);cursor:pointer}._actions_1nayg_46{display:flex;align-items:center;gap:var(--space-3)}._desktopOnly_1nayg_52{display:none}._navMobile_1nayg_56{position:fixed;top:var(--header-h);left:0;right:0;bottom:0;background-color:var(--secondary);z-index:1000;display:flex;flex-direction:column;justify-content:space-between;opacity:0;visibility:hidden;transition:opacity .3s ease,visibility .3s ease}._navMobileOpen_1nayg_72{opacity:1;visibility:visible}._navMobileLinks_1nayg_77{display:flex;flex-direction:column;align-items:start;padding:var(--space-8) var(--space-4);background-color:var(--primary);flex:1;gap:var(--space-8);overflow-y:auto;-webkit-overflow-scrolling:touch}._navMobileLinks_1nayg_77 a{color:var(--color-white);text-decoration:none;font-size:var(--text-lg)}._navMobileLinks_1nayg_77 a._active_1nayg_95{text-decoration:underline;font-weight:var(--font-semibold);text-underline-offset:var(--space-1)}@media only screen and (min-width:992px){._header_1nayg_1{--header-h: var(--space-24)}._logo_1nayg_32{height:var(--space-16);margin-block:var(--space-6)}._logoLink_1nayg_32{position:static;transform:none}._mobileOnly_1nayg_116{display:none}._desktopOnly_1nayg_52{display:flex}._navDesktop_1nayg_124{display:flex;align-items:center;gap:var(--space-3)}._navDesktop_1nayg_124 a{color:var(--color-black);text-decoration:none}._navDesktop_1nayg_124 a._active_1nayg_95{text-decoration:underline;font-weight:var(--font-semibold);text-underline-offset:var(--space-1)}}@media only screen and (min-width:1100px){._navDesktop_1nayg_124{gap:var(--space-8)}}._footer_197ut_1{display:flex;flex-direction:column;justify-content:space-between;align-items:center;color:var(--muted-foreground)}._link_197ut_9{margin-left:var(--space-2);text-decoration:none;color:var(--muted-foreground)}._link_197ut_9:hover{color:var(--color-black)}._links_197ut_19{display:flex;justify-content:flex-end;flex-direction:row;flex-wrap:wrap}._link_197ut_9:not(:first-child):before{content:"·";margin-right:var(--space-2)}@media only screen and (min-width:768px){._footer_197ut_1{flex-direction:row}}._landing_ln5dr_1{display:flex;flex-direction:column;min-height:100dvh;overflow-x:clip}._body_ln5dr_8{flex:1;display:flex;flex-direction:column;gap:var(--space-8)}@media only screen and (min-width:1920px){._landing_ln5dr_1>*{zoom:1.25}}@supports (hanging-punctuation: first){@media only screen and (min-width:1920px){._landing_ln5dr_1>*{zoom:unset}._landing_ln5dr_1{min-height:80dvh!important}}}
